When I hold the switch up window closes then drops down to full open. It will not stay closed while holding the switch.
Hold the switch in the first up position, and continue holding it after the windows closed for one second. Do not pull the window switch all the way up and activate the one touch feature. There are five switch positions:

One touch up
Manual up
Idle
Manual down
One touch down
